@@ -0,0 +1,29 @@+# streamly-cassava++Stream CSV data in\/out using+[Cassava](http://hackage.haskell.org/package/cassava). Adapted from+[streaming-cassava](http://hackage.haskell.org/package/streaming-cassava).++For efficiency, operates on streams of strict ByteString chunks +(i.e. `IsStream t => t m ByteString`) rather than directly on streams of Word8. +The chunkStream function is useful for generating an input stream from a+handle.++Example usage:++```haskell+import Streamly+import qualified Streamly.Prelude as S+import Streamly.Csv (decode, encode, chunkStream)+import System.IO+import qualified Data.Csv as Csv+import qualified Data.ByteString as BS+import Data.Vector (Vector)++main = do+ h <- openFile "testfile.csv" ReadMode+ let chunks = chunkStream h (64*1024)+ recs = decode Csv.HasHeader chunks :: SerialT IO (Vector BS.ByteString)+ withFile "dest.csv" WriteMode $ \ho ->+ S.mapM_ (BS.hPut ho) $ encode Nothing recs+```
